get-bugzilla-attachments-by-mimetype: query different bzs concurrently
Downside is we can't easily detect when one tracker is done, but it should be faster. Change-Id: Ie78ddf0381690040d7a4fa06f910717fcdfe0eae Reviewed-on: https://gerrit.libreoffice.org/c/core/+/128038 Tested-by: Jenkins Reviewed-by: Michael Stahl <michael.stahl@allotropia.de>
